We offer a full-service solution from initial discussions about your project to final reporting.


Here’s how it works:

  • Project scoping.

    During this phase, we’ll work with you to define your project, e.g. location, budget, and biodiversity goals. Based on this discussion, we’ll create a project plan for your approval, and we’ll agree on the type and number of reefs as well as the type of monitoring

  • Baseline survey.

    To understand the initial biodiversity of the site, we will conduct a baseline survey prior to the installation of the artificial reefs. This will serve as a reference point to assess future changes in biodiversity

  • Production.

    With our production partners, we will begin 3D printing your artificial reefs. The time for this depends on the number of reefs produced. For an estimate of how long it will take to print your reefs, please get in touch. 

  • Installation.

    We will arrange for the artificial reefs to be delivered to the site and installed.

  • Monitoring.

    Once the reefs are installed, we will begin monitoring the artificial reefs at regular intervals to assess their impact on biodiversity. We offer a range of monitoring based on your needs, e.g. underwater cameras with AI species recognition, photogrammetry, eDNA analysis, or standard monitoring techniques.

  • Reporting.

    We will analyse the data collected during monitoring and provide you with an annual biodiversity report.
